Publisher's Summary
Historien starter på baren Mexico-City i Amsterdam hvor fortælleren Clamence antaster en tilfældig bargæst - og samtidig læseren - og starter sin besnærende monolog om sin turbulente tilværelse, fortællingen om et pænt og borgerligt livs fald.
En nat hører Clamence et skrig fra floden, men han finder aldrig ud af, hvad der skete, for han tør ikke undersøge sagen. Denne begivenhed skal siden hjemsøge ham og bliver et eksistentielt vendepunkt. For lader vi ikke alt for ofte skæbnen afgøre livet for os, af frygt for selv at træffe valg?
Camus' FALDET udkom første gang på dansk i 1957 og genudgives nu i Hans Peter Lunds nyoversættelse.
